Singapore electricity prices

The residential electricity price in Singapore is SGD 0.325 per kWh or USD 0.240. The electricity price for businesses is SGD 0.355 kWh or USD 0.262. These retail prices were collected in June 2024 and include the cost of power, distribution and transmission, and all taxes and fees. Compare Singapore with 150 other countries.

Electricity price analysis for Singapore

  • Residential electricity prices in Singapore are 158.78% of the world average electricity price and 286.24% of the average price in Asia.


  • Business electricity rates in Singapore are 176.17% of the world average price and 242.00% of the average in Asia.


  • Household rates are 91.55% of the business rates.


  • Electricity prices paid by small businesses in Singapore are 100.00% of the prices paid by big businesses.


  • The price paid by households with low electricity consumption is 100.00% of the price paid by households with high electricity consumption.

The energy mix of Singapore

Based on the United States Energy Information Adminstration data from 2022, electricity in Singapore is produced from the following sources: fossil fuels 97.78%, wind 0.00%, solar 2.22%, hydro 0.00%, nuclear 0.00%, and geothermal 0.00%.
